The lifespan of an automatic hair curler is not a fixed number; it varies significantly depending on several interconnected factors. These can be broadly categorized into:

1. Quality of Components: This is arguably the most crucial factor. Low-quality components, often found in cheaper models, are more prone to failure. Consider the following:
Motor: The motor is the heart of the curler. A high-quality, durable motor will withstand frequent use and generate consistent torque. Inferior motors might overheat, lose power, or fail altogether after a relatively short period. Look for motors with higher wattage and robust construction. Consider the type of motor used - DC motors generally offer better performance and longer lifespan than AC motors in this application.
Heating Element: The heating element is responsible for achieving the desired temperature. A well-designed heating element will heat up quickly, maintain a consistent temperature, and resist damage from overheating. Cheaper elements might be less efficient, leading to inconsistent curling or premature burnout.
Internal Wiring and Circuitry: Robust wiring and a well-protected circuit board are vital for preventing short circuits and malfunctions. Cheaply made wiring and poorly designed circuit boards are susceptible to damage from heat and vibrations, potentially leading to electrical hazards or complete failure.
Barrel Material: The barrel material is critical for both curling performance and longevity. Higher-quality materials like ceramic or tourmaline-infused ceramic offer better heat distribution and are more resistant to scratches and wear and tear than cheaper plastic barrels.
Sensors and Internal Mechanisms: Automatic curlers rely on sensors and internal mechanisms to precisely control the curling process. The reliability and precision of these components directly influence the lifespan and performance of the device. Poorly manufactured parts can lead to malfunctions such as inconsistent curling or premature failure of the device.

2. Frequency and Intensity of Use: The more frequently the curler is used, and the more intensely it's used (higher heat settings, longer curling times), the faster its components will wear out. Daily use will naturally shorten the lifespan compared to occasional use. Improper use, such as leaving the curler on for extended periods without use or winding excessively thick or wet hair, will also impact its longevity.

3. Maintenance and Care: Proper maintenance significantly extends the life of any appliance. Regular cleaning of the barrel and avoiding exposure to water or extreme temperatures are essential. Storing the curler in its protective case when not in use also prevents accidental damage.

4. Brand Reputation and Warranty: Reputable brands often invest in higher-quality components and rigorous testing, resulting in more durable products. The warranty offered by the manufacturer also reflects the brand’s confidence in its product’s lifespan. A longer warranty typically indicates greater confidence in the product's reliability.

5. Manufacturing Processes and Quality Control: The manufacturing process plays a vital role. Factories employing stringent quality control measures are more likely to produce curlers with longer lifespans. Importers should prioritize working with suppliers who adhere to high manufacturing standards and provide comprehensive quality control documentation.

Estimating Lifespan: While a precise lifespan is impossible to predict, a well-made, high-quality automatic hair curler, used moderately and maintained properly, can reasonably last for 2-3 years or even longer. Conversely, lower-quality models might only last for a few months or a year before requiring repair or replacement.
